Types of Corner Beads

A corner bead is a crucial component in drywall construction, used to reinforce and protect wall corners during finishing. It provides a straight, durable edge that resists chipping and impact damage while ensuring a clean, professional appearance. Corner beads are especially important in high-traffic areas and are available in various materials to suit different environmental conditions, performance needs, and aesthetic goals.

This guide explores the most common types of corner beads, their benefits, limitations, and ideal applications to help you choose the right one for your project.

Metal Corner Beads

Made from galvanized steel or aluminum, metal corner beads are the most widely used type due to their strength and durability. They provide a sharp, crisp edge that enhances the visual finish of drywall joints.

Advantages
  • Exceptional durability and impact resistance
  • Resists dents and deformation in high-traffic areas
  • Galvanized coating prevents rust and corrosion
  • Provides a clean, straight edge for professional finishes
  • Long-lasting performance in interior and protected exterior applications
Limitations
  • Prone to rust if coating is damaged (especially in moist environments)
  • Heavier and harder to cut than plastic alternatives
  • Can corrode over time in high-humidity areas without proper sealing
  • May require additional joint compound layers for full embedment

Best for: Interior walls, hallways, commercial buildings, and areas with frequent human contact

Vinyl Rounded Corner Bead

Vinyl corner beads offer a flexible, rustproof solution ideal for creating smooth, rounded edges on drywall. Their pliability allows them to conform to curved walls and corners, offering both safety and aesthetic appeal.

Advantages
  • Completely rustproof and corrosion-resistant
  • Flexible design ideal for curved or arched corners
  • Lightweight and easy to install
  • Soft edge reduces risk of injury—ideal for homes with children
  • Performs well in humid environments like bathrooms and basements
Limitations
  • Less rigid than metal—may not hold sharp edges as precisely
  • Limited structural reinforcement compared to metal
  • Potential for warping under extreme heat or direct sunlight
  • Fewer profile options compared to traditional corner beads

Best for: Bathrooms, basements, nurseries, elderly care facilities, and curved architectural features

Paper-Faced Corner Beads

These corner beads feature a rigid metal or fiberglass core wrapped in paper facing on both sides. The paper allows seamless integration with drywall joint compound, making it easier to achieve a flush, paint-ready finish.

Advantages
  • Easy to embed in joint compound for a smooth transition
  • Creates a sharp, durable edge with excellent adhesion
  • Compatible with standard drywall finishing techniques
  • Helps control moisture transfer at corners
  • Ideal for seamless, paint-grade finishes
Limitations
  • Paper can absorb moisture if not properly sealed
  • Less impact-resistant than solid metal beads
  • May degrade in prolonged wet conditions
  • Requires careful application to avoid bubbling or peeling

Best for: Standard interior drywall projects, residential construction, and paint-grade walls

Fiberglass Corner Beads

Fiberglass corner beads are non-metallic, moisture-resistant reinforcements made from woven fiberglass strands embedded in a resin matrix. They are engineered for extreme environments where rust and moisture are major concerns.

Advantages
  • Completely rustproof and non-corrosive
  • Ideal for exterior applications and wet areas (e.g., showers, pool rooms)
  • Flexible enough to fit various corner angles
  • Lightweight and easy to handle
  • Resists mold, mildew, and water damage
Limitations
  • Less rigid than metal—may require additional support in wide gaps
  • Can be more difficult to achieve a perfectly straight edge
  • Slightly higher material cost than basic metal beads
  • May require specialty joint compounds for optimal adhesion

Best for: Bathrooms, exterior soffits, shower enclosures, coastal buildings, and high-moisture commercial spaces

Type Durability Moisture Resistance Impact Resistance Best Application
Metal Corner Bead Excellent Good (if galvanized) Excellent Interior hallways, commercial walls, high-traffic zones
Vinyl Rounded Bead Good Excellent Fair Bathrooms, curved walls, child-safe areas
Paper-Faced Bead Good Good (when sealed) Good Standard drywall, residential interiors, paint finishes
Fiberglass Bead Very Good Excellent Good Wet areas, exteriors, showers, high-humidity zones

Expert Tip: Always prime and seal corner beads—especially metal and paper-faced types—before painting in humid environments. This prevents moisture absorption and extends the life of your drywall finish.

Rounded Corner Bead Installation Instructions

Installing rounded corner beads on drywall not only enhances the aesthetic appeal of interior spaces but also significantly improves durability by protecting vulnerable wall corners from dents, impacts, and wear. When properly installed, these beads create smooth, professional-looking curved edges that are both visually pleasing and functional. Achieving a flawless finish requires careful preparation, precise measurements, and attention to detail throughout each step of the installation process.

Gather Necessary Tools and Materials

Before beginning the installation, assemble all required tools, materials, and personal protective equipment (PPE) to ensure a safe and efficient workflow. Having everything on hand minimizes interruptions and helps maintain consistent progress.

Essential Tools

  • Utility Knife: For trimming drywall edges and cutting paper or vinyl corner beads.
  • Metal Snips or Metal-Cutting Blade: Required for cleanly cutting metal or fiberglass corner beads without deformation.
  • Drywall Knife (4" and 6"): Used for applying and smoothing joint compound over the bead.
  • Measuring Tape: Ensures accurate length measurements for precise cuts.
  • Sanding Sponge or Sandpaper (120–150 grit): For smoothing dried compound between coats.

Materials & Safety Gear

  • Rounded Corner Bead: Available in metal, fiberglass, vinyl, or paper-faced varieties—choose based on application and moisture exposure.
  • Joint Compound (All-Purpose or Lightweight): Acts as adhesive and finishing medium; lightweight dries faster and sands easier.
  • Construction Adhesive (Optional for Vinyl): Provides extra hold when installing flexible vinyl beads.
  • PPE – Goggles, Gloves, Safety Boots: Protects against dust, sharp edges, and accidental injury during cutting and sanding.

Prepare the Drywall Surface

Proper surface preparation is crucial for ensuring strong adhesion and a seamless final appearance. Any imperfections in the drywall can telegraph through the joint compound and compromise the finished look.

  • Clean the Area: Remove dust, debris, and grease using a damp cloth or dry brush. Allow the surface to dry completely before proceeding.
  • Inspect for Damage: Check for loose seams, dents, or uneven joints. Repair any damaged drywall sections before installing the corner bead.
  • Trim Irregular Edges: Use a utility knife to clean up frayed or uneven drywall corners. A straight, clean edge ensures better alignment and a smoother transition with the bead.
  • Ensure Square Alignment: Verify that the walls meet at a true 90-degree angle. Minor misalignments can be corrected with compound; major issues should be addressed structurally.

Measure and Cut the Corner Bead

Accurate measurement and clean cutting are essential to achieving a professional fit. Poorly cut beads can result in gaps, bulges, or an uneven curve profile.

  • Measure Twice: Use a measuring tape to determine the exact length needed. For tall walls, measure from floor to ceiling; for shorter sections, mark endpoints clearly.
  • Cutting Techniques by Material:
    • Metal/Fiberglass Beads: Use metal snips or a utility knife with a metal-cutting blade. Score along the length and bend back and forth to snap cleanly.
    • Vinyl or Paper-Faced Beads: Score with a sharp utility knife and break along the cut line for a straight edge.
  • Test Fit: Hold the cut bead in place before adhering it to confirm proper alignment and coverage. Make minor adjustments as needed.

Install the Corner Bead

The installation method varies slightly depending on the type of corner bead used, but the goal remains the same: secure, centered placement with full contact along the corner.

Metal & Fiberglass Beads

  • Apply a thin, even layer of joint compound along both sides of the inside or outside corner.
  • Press the bead firmly into the wet compound, centering it precisely on the corner.
  • Use a drywall knife to embed the flanges into the compound, forcing material up into the grooves for maximum adhesion.
  • Ensure the rounded profile is symmetrical and free of kinks or bends.

Vinyl & Flexible Beads

  • Apply construction adhesive to the back of the bead or a thin bed of joint compound on the corner.
  • Press the bead into place, starting at the top and working downward to avoid air pockets.
  • Smooth gently with a damp sponge or knife to ensure full contact without distorting the shape.
  • Vinyl beads often self-adhere and may not require additional fasteners in standard applications.

Apply and Finish Joint Compound

After the corner bead is securely embedded, apply successive layers of joint compound to build a smooth, continuous transition from wall to bead.

  • First Coat: Using a 6" drywall knife, apply a thin, even layer of compound over the bead, feathering the edges outward to blend with the wall surface. Ensure the compound fills all gaps and fully covers the bead flanges.
  • Drying Time: Allow the first coat to dry completely (typically 12–24 hours depending on humidity and compound type).
  • Sanding: Lightly sand the dried compound with 120–150 grit sandpaper or a sanding sponge to remove ridges and create a smooth base. Wipe away dust before applying the next coat.
  • Second and Final Coats: Apply 1–2 additional thin coats, increasing the width of the spread each time to further feather the edges. Sand lightly between coats for a seamless finish.

Important: Always follow manufacturer instructions for drying times, compatible compounds, and safety precautions. Avoid applying thick layers of joint compound, as this increases drying time and risk of cracking. For best results, work in a well-ventilated area and wear appropriate PPE during sanding to avoid inhaling dust. A properly installed rounded corner bead should feel smooth to the touch and visually blend seamlessly into the wall, creating a durable, attractive edge that withstands daily use.

Factors to Consider When Choosing a Rounded Corner Bead

Selecting the appropriate rounded corner bead is essential for achieving both aesthetic appeal and structural durability in drywall installations. The right choice enhances the longevity of wall corners while complementing the overall design style of the space. Whether you're working on a modern minimalist interior or a high-traffic commercial environment, understanding the key selection criteria ensures professional results and long-term performance.

Important Note: Always match the corner bead type and material to the specific application—interior vs. exterior, high-impact zones vs. decorative areas—to ensure optimal durability and finish quality.

Material

The material of the corner bead significantly influences its performance, ease of installation, and suitability for different environments. Common materials include metal, vinyl, paper-faced, and fiberglass, each with distinct advantages:

  • Metal Corner Beads: Made from galvanized or stainless steel, these offer superior strength and impact resistance. Ideal for hallways, commercial buildings, and other high-traffic areas where corners are prone to damage.
  • Vinyl (PVC) Corner Beads: Flexible and corrosion-resistant, vinyl beads are excellent for curved or arched walls. They are easy to cut and install, making them popular in both residential and light commercial projects.
  • Paper-Faced Corner Beads: Constructed with a metal core wrapped in paper facing, these provide a smooth surface that bonds exceptionally well with joint compound. Their thin, pliable nature makes them ideal for flat, smooth corners in low-impact areas like bedrooms or offices.
  • Fiberglass Corner Beads: Lightweight and moisture-resistant, fiberglass options are often used in damp environments such as bathrooms or basements. They resist rust and are compatible with most taping compounds.

Pro Tip: In areas exposed to moisture or humidity, consider using vinyl or fiberglass corner beads to prevent rusting and deterioration over time.

Corner Radius

The radius of a rounded corner bead refers to the curvature of the edge, measured from the center of the arc to the face of the bead. This dimension plays a crucial role in determining the visual softness and safety of the corner:

  • Small Radius (1/4" to 1"): These create a subtly rounded edge, often preferred in contemporary and modern interiors. They offer a clean, minimalist look while still reducing sharpness for safety.
  • Medium Radius (1" to 2"): Balances aesthetics and safety, commonly used in family homes, schools, and healthcare facilities. Provides a noticeable curve without appearing overly bulky.
  • Large Radius (2" to 3.5"): Produces a dramatically soft, flowing corner ideal for curved walls, archways, or luxury design applications. Offers maximum impact resistance and a premium, sculpted appearance.

A larger radius not only enhances visual appeal but also reduces the risk of injury from accidental bumps, making it a smart choice for homes with children or elderly occupants.

Inside vs Outside Corner Beading

Understanding the functional differences between inside and outside corner beads is critical for proper application and performance:

  • Inside Corner Beads: Used at internal angles (typically 90° or greater), such as where two walls meet in a recessed corner. These beads are designed to be smooth and flat, allowing for seamless application of joint compound. They minimize stress on the drywall tape, reducing cracking and improving finish quality.
  • Outside Corner Beads: Applied to external edges where walls project outward. These are built for durability, often featuring a rigid metal or reinforced vinyl core with a sharp or slightly rounded nose to protect against dents and abrasions. Some models include integrated flanges or wings for secure attachment.

Note: While "rounded" corner beads typically refer to outside corners with a curved profile, similar soft-edge options are available for inside corners in specialty applications like curved partitions or decorative walls.

Thickness

The thickness of a corner bead affects both its structural integrity and how it integrates with the surrounding drywall:

  • Thin Beads (1/4" to 1/2"): Typically made of paper-faced or lightweight vinyl, these are best suited for standard residential walls where impact is minimal. They blend easily with the wall surface and require less compound for finishing.
  • Thick Beads (3/4" to 1"): Usually constructed from heavy-gauge metal or reinforced vinyl, these provide enhanced protection and are commonly used in commercial or industrial settings. The added thickness helps absorb impacts and maintain corner integrity over time.

Thicker beads may require additional joint compound to feather smoothly into the wall surface, but they offer superior longevity and resistance to wear.

Factor Best For Limitations Recommended Applications
Material – Metal Durability, sharp edges, high-traffic zones Prone to rust if not coated; heavier to install Commercial buildings, hallways, entryways
Material – Vinyl Flexibility, moisture resistance, curved walls Less rigid than metal; may deform under heavy impact Bathrooms, arches, curved partitions
Radius – Small (≤1") Modern aesthetics, subtle rounding Still relatively sharp; limited safety benefit Living rooms, offices, contemporary designs
Radius – Large (2"–3.5") Safety, luxury finish, impact absorption Requires more compound; higher material cost Homes with children, healthcare facilities, high-end interiors
Thickness – 1" Maximum protection, structural reinforcement Bulky appearance; needs skilled finishing Industrial spaces, schools, public buildings

Expert Insight: When installing rounded corner beads, always perform a dry fit first—hold the bead in place and check alignment before securing it. This prevents costly adjustments later and ensures a consistent radius along the entire length.

Additional Selection Tips

  • Consider the final paint and lighting—rounded corners cast softer shadows, which can enhance or alter the perceived space.
  • Match the corner bead finish to your joint compound type (e.g., setting-type vs. ready-mix) for optimal adhesion.
  • For curved walls, choose flexible vinyl or fiberglass beads that can bend without kinking.
  • Always follow manufacturer guidelines for embedding depth and compound layering to avoid cracking.
  • In seismic or high-movement areas, use flexible corner beads that can accommodate minor structural shifts.

Ultimately, selecting the right rounded corner bead involves balancing design intent, environmental conditions, and performance requirements. By carefully evaluating material, radius, application type, and thickness, you can achieve a durable, visually pleasing finish that stands the test of time and use.

Frequently Asked Questions About Drywall Corner Beads

Q1: What is a rounded corner bead used for?

A1: A rounded corner bead serves the essential purpose of reinforcing and protecting the external edges of drywall during installation and repair. Like traditional corner beads, it provides a durable framework that supports the joint compound, ensuring a clean, uniform, and long-lasting finish along exposed wall corners.

Specifically, the rounded design creates a smooth, curved edge instead of a sharp 90-degree angle, which not only enhances safety but also contributes to a more modern and visually appealing aesthetic. This makes it especially popular in residential construction, hallways, and high-traffic areas where durability and appearance are both important.

  • Structural Support: Prevents chipping and cracking at vulnerable drywall corners.
  • Finish Enhancement: Provides a consistent radius for taping and mudding, making it easier to achieve a professional result.
  • Durability: Withstands minor impacts better than unprotected drywall edges.
Q2: Are corner beads necessary?

A2: While corner beads are not strictly mandatory for every drywall project, they are highly recommended—especially on external corners that are prone to damage. Without a corner bead, drywall edges are fragile and susceptible to dents, chipping, and deterioration over time due to everyday wear and impact.

Using corner beads significantly improves both the longevity and visual quality of drywall installations. They help maintain clean, straight lines and reduce the need for frequent repairs. In professional construction and remodeling, corner beads are considered a standard best practice for achieving polished, durable results.

  • For DIYers: Corner beads simplify the finishing process and improve the final look, even for beginners.
  • For Contractors: Their use ensures compliance with industry standards and client expectations for quality craftsmanship.
  • Alternatives: Some opt for wood or metal moldings, but these are more expensive and time-consuming to install compared to modern corner bead solutions.
Q3: Can I use joint compound instead of thinset on corner bead?

A3: Yes, joint compound can be used to embed and finish metal or paper-faced corner beads on standard drywall, particularly in interior, dry environments. However, the choice between joint compound and thinset mortar depends heavily on the substrate and location.

For example, when installing corner beads on cement backer board in wet areas—such as bathrooms, showers, or exterior walls—thinset is required to ensure a strong, moisture-resistant bond. Joint compound lacks the structural strength and water resistance needed in these conditions and may degrade over time if exposed to humidity or direct water contact.

Application Recommended Adhesive Reason
Interior drywall (living rooms, bedrooms) Joint compound Sufficient adhesion; easy to work with and sand.
Bathrooms, showers, laundry rooms Thinset mortar Waterproof bond; compatible with cement board.
Exterior soffits or siding Thinset or exterior-grade adhesive Resists weathering, temperature changes, and moisture.
Rounded vinyl corner beads Specialty adhesive or flexible joint compound Maintains flexibility and prevents cracking.

In summary: Joint compound is ideal for finishing and embedding corner beads indoors, while thinset is essential for durability and moisture protection in wet or exterior applications.

Q4: Why use a rounded corner bead instead of a traditional one?

A4: Rounded corner beads offer several advantages over traditional sharp-angle (90-degree) corner beads, making them increasingly popular in modern construction and renovation projects.

The most notable benefit is safety—rounded edges are less likely to cause injury upon impact, which is especially important in homes with children, elderly individuals, or high-traffic commercial spaces. Additionally, the soft curve diffuses light more evenly, reducing harsh shadows and creating a more inviting atmosphere.

  • Safety: Minimizes risk of cuts, bruises, or injuries from accidental bumps.
  • Aesthetics: Delivers a contemporary, softer look that complements modern interior designs.
  • Durability: Less prone to chipping than sharp edges, particularly in hallways, doorways, and stairwells.
  • Ease of Finishing: The consistent radius simplifies the taping and sanding process for drywall professionals.
  • Design Flexibility: Available in various radii (e.g., 1/4", 3/8") and materials (metal, vinyl, plastic) to suit different styles and applications.

While traditional corner beads provide a crisp, formal appearance preferred in some architectural styles, rounded beads are favored for their functionality, comfort, and resilience in everyday use.

Q5: Should I glue or screw the corner bead?

A5: The method of securing corner bead—whether by fasteners (nails or screws) or adhesive—depends on the material, substrate, and application environment.

For most standard metal or paper-faced corner beads on drywall, drywall nails or screws are commonly used to temporarily hold the bead in place until the joint compound is applied. These fasteners ensure precise alignment and prevent shifting during the finishing process. Once the joint compound sets, it becomes the primary bonding agent, and the fasteners remain embedded for added reinforcement.

However, in certain cases—particularly with flexible vinyl or plastic corner beads—adhesive is preferred. Gluing allows the bead to move slightly with the structure, reducing the risk of cracking due to building settlement or temperature fluctuations. It also creates a seamless appearance without visible fastener holes.

Corner Bead Type Installation Method Best For
Metal or paper-faced Nails or screws + joint compound Standard interior drywall corners
Vinyl or flexible plastic Construction adhesive or specialized glue Bathrooms, curved walls, moisture-prone areas
Exterior cement board Corrosion-resistant screws + thinset Outdoor soffits, stucco, or siding transitions
Pre-finished or decorative Adhesive only or hybrid method Renovations where minimal wall penetration is desired

In all cases, always follow the manufacturer’s instructions and ensure the surface is clean, dry, and properly prepared before installation. Proper installation ensures a durable, attractive finish that will last for years.
